China Shen Zhou Mining & Resources, Inc. Announces Completion of New Nonferrous Processing Plant in Xinjiang

- 200K-metric Ton Annual Designed Capacity -

- Grand Ribbon-Cutting Ceremony to be Held April 29 -

- Company Expanding Nonferrous Metal Explorations in Xinjiang -

BEIJING, April 24 /Xinhua-PRNewswire-FirstCall/ -- China Shen Zhou Mining & Resources, Inc. (Amex: SHZ) ("China Shen Zhou", or "the Company"), a leading company engaged in the exploration, development, mining and processing of fluorite, zinc, lead, copper, and other nonferrous metals in China, today announced the completion of its construction of a new nonferrous metal concentrator in northern Xinjiang Uyghur Autonomous Region. A grand ribbon-cutting ceremony to inaugurate the new plant will be held on April 29, 2008, with commercial production ensuing immediately.

The all-new nonferrous metal concentrator will process copper, zinc and lead ores and turn them into metal ingots and has an annual designed production capacity of 200,000 metric tons. The facility is located in Buerjiin County in northern Xinjiang, about 3 miles from the Company’s Keyinbulake nonferrous-metal mine, which has a government mining license valid until August 2013. The Keyinbulake deposit is situated in one of the most geologically rich regions of Xinjiang.

About China Shen Zhou Mining & Resources, Inc.

China Shen Zhou Mining & Resources, Inc., through its subsidiary, American Federal Mining Group ("AFMG"), is engaged in the exploration, development, mining, and processing of fluorite and nonferrous metals such as zinc, lead and copper in China. The Company has the following principal areas of interest in China: (a) fluorite exploration and extraction in the Sumochaganaobao region of Inner Mongolia; (b) zinc/copper/lead exploration, mining and processing in Wulatehouqi of Inner Mongolia; and (c) zinc/copper exploration, mining and processing in Xinjiang. In addition, AFMG owns 100% of Kichi-Chaarat Closed Joint Stock Company, whose major assets include a copper-gold mine located in the Kuru-Tegerek region of western Kyrgyzstan.
